Objectives: To document the chemical and biologic profile of a clinical phase II red clover (Trifolium pratense L.) extract by identifying and measuring the major and minor components visible in the high-performance liquid chromatography-ultraviolet (HPLC-UV) chromatogram and evaluating each compound for estrogenic and antioxidant ... goffstown fire department goffstown nhWebRed clover ( Trifolium pratense L.) is widely used throughout eastern North America. It is adapted to a wide range of soil types and tolerates a pH as low as 5.5. It is a short-lived perennial that usually persists only 2 or 3 years due to susceptibility to a number of root diseases. Newer varieties may last longer than this. goffstown fire nhWebRed clover is a perennial plant grown widely and cultivated as a forage grass in many countries. Red clover (Trifolium pratense) is one of the most important forage legume crops in temperate agriculture, and a key component of sustainable intensification of livestock farming systems.Red clover is a highly heterozygous diploid (2n = 14) species due to its gametophytic self-incompatibility system.
